Apple received clearance from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ration for two game-changing features: an ECG app capable of taking electrocardiograms on the go, and an atrial fibrillation feature that alerts you when you experience five irregular heart rhythms. The Apple Watch Series 4 still lasts about 24 hours on a charge, the same as every model preceding it. Apple aims to deliver 18 hours on a charge, but it can easily cruise through an entire day. The Apple Watch Series 4 is a smartwatch with a larger screen, better cellular connectivity, and more advanced health features than previous models. It has a large screen, good call quality, ECG capability, fall detection, and WatchOS 5 with numerous improvements. It is expensive, battery life is unchanged, and it does not have built-in sleep tracking.
